LEFTY MAX 140
SPV - STABLE PLATFORM VALVE
Features the Manitou SPV compression damper. Adjust
SPV air pressure and volume externally to control pedaling
platform and progressive or linear damping. Additional
features include the Cannondale-Specific rebound system
which provides external rebound damping control with an
indexed dial and wider range of adjustment.
TPC - TWIN PISTON CHAMBER
Features independent damping pistons: one optimized for
rebound, and the other for compression. Additionally, we use
a low pressure, high volume system to eliminate cavitation
(which leads to compression spikes and stiffening) and heat
related problems. Our Quick Range TPC allows minimum to
maximum compression damping adjustment in a half-turn of
the knob. With the combination of Quick Range TPC and the
Cannondale-Specific rebound system, riders can quickly and
easily tune ride qualities.
FFD - FLUID FLOW DAMPING
A TPC derived hydraulic damping system featuring compression
and externally adjustable rebound damping pistons. We use
a low pressure, high volume system to eliminate cavitation
(which leads to compression spikes and stiffening) and heat-
related problems. The FFD still uses the Cannondale-Specific
rebound system.

lefty max 140
1 - REBOUND KNOB (SPV, TPC and FFD forks)
Controls the speed at which the fork extends
following compression.
SLOWER
Turn clockwise "+" to increase
rebound damping which slows
the rebound speed.
FASTER
Turn the knob counter-
clockwise "-" to decrease
rebound damping which
increases the rebound speed.
2 - SPV PRESSURE (SPV forks only)
Controls pedaling platform of the fork. Pedaling
platform is the fork’s tendency to resist
compression under the force of pedaling.
MORE PRESSURE Stiffer pedaling platform
LESS PRESSURE Softer pedaling platform
3 - SPV VOLUME (SPV forks only)
Controls the volume of the internal SPV
compression bladder. Change air volume by
turning the red 16 mm hex.
PROGRESSIVE Turn clockwise to increase
bottoming resistance
LINEAR
Turn counter-clockwise to
decrease bottoming resistance
